With @admin talking about mixing up br for port battles and mabey introducing raiding in the future. It's dawned on me that our port battles don't include the port....

What I suggest is adding a port with ships to every port battle.

The simplest way of this is a slim brown rectangle floating in the dock position. (this would represent the jetty) with four ships positioned with rear of ship facing the jetty. 

The four ships should include two traders and two, top class battleships for the port battle.

The positioning of the four ships would place the warships on the outside facing the battle with traders protected behind the warships. (the warships would be AI controlled, unable to move but can fire cannons)

Currently towers give points once destroyed, I'd propose giving a point bonus for destroying the four ships. Destroying the four ships would give the points of sinking two ships. Or a set point total.

If raiding ever gets added, the number of docked ships could be increased and those traders need capturing to raid the goods. Again giving a focal point to the pb. To gain more points or to raid resources the trade ships must be captured.

Adding a dock with point rewarding ships forces the defender to hunt the mortor Brigg, meaning mono fleets would be silly.

Also players like myself who enjoy fireships would have a target for battles...

Adding a port with point giving ships would also open up future possibilities for upgrading the hp of the dock... Upgrading the hp of the ships in dock etc. If the ports were capped at 1 million tax revenue per day with a stage one port (4 ships in port), a stage two port (8 ships in port) would have no tax revenue cap per day.

The stage two port would open the door to more tax revenue but make the port slightly easier to capture in theory. 

This port idea opens the door to raiding, more versatility in pbs and port customization.

Ideas welcome (on phone so format is iffy)

Is it a miniature Battle of Aboukir Bay (Nelson's Battle of the Nile) or Copenhagan that inspires the idea?

I like the idea in principle,  in theory the attacker could decide   whether he is simply raiding the port or taking the port, Raiding could be simply sinking warships or 'Cutting them out' along with any merchant ships  in the harbour and a small scale raid ashore with Marines before withdrawing, or a full on attempt to take the port with mortar Brigs and a ship load of marines to take facilities in addition to the attacking fleet

A clan or nation may not particularly want the port they are attacking, so raiding gives them an option for PvP/RVR without the expense of paying for a port if he wins and also allows the defender to keep enough of their assets so they can get up, dust themselves off and fight another day without the fear of being one ported or effectively put out of  the game due to lack of resources.

Much of the coding will I think be already written, all that would  be required is that the game  is told prior to the battle what kind of battle it would be so it can award points and gold appropriately,

Small clans and nations could benefit in that they get to experience PVP/RVR in the form of a more affordable raid rather than face the huge expense of a full port battle and overreach by losing an overly large proportion of their assets on the roll of a dice. It is also something the Pirates I think would excel at, the thought of messing up the well laid plans for a nation's port battle or simply the rewards of a raid would be equally enjoyable to some of them and one would hope, provide for open water PVP in the area at the same time.
